About The Role
Join the platform team at a well-funded AI/ML data analytics startup building an agentic data lakehouse that delivers trustworthy answers from messy enterprise data. You'll help shape the data foundation that enables AI-driven analytics at scale — without heavy schema migrations or data movement. This is a high-impact, zero-to-one engineering role at an early-stage company backed by top-tier investors.
What You'll Do
- Agentic Semantic Layer: Build the system that gives AI agents the context to query enterprise data correctly and the guardrails to prove their results — turning AI-generated queries into something teams can actually rely on.
- Distributed Agent Orchestration: Design and implement orchestration systems for distributed agents, including API integrations, rate limiting, OAuth passthrough, model routing, scheduling, and token optimization.
- Agentic Data Engineering: Architect AI-centric ETL pipelines for data lakehouses, enabling large-scale analytics for organizations with minimal data engineering resources.
- Contribute across infrastructure, services, or frontend as needed in a small, fast-moving team.
